My America

2 min read

Nancy KUHNS

Mill Hall

As a child I was taught to love, honor and cherish this country. It was a country where we worked out our differences. A country where there was not so much hatred as today. A country where I had the privacy between my doctor and myself to decide what was right for my body. A country where we looked after one another. A country where we did not think any job was too menial, like field work, janitorial, etc.

Now businesses are still looking to hire because no one wants to work, no matter what level the job is. I was taught to honor vets and to remember those who did not survive wars, not to call them suckers and losers. A country that aided those afar in times of need. A country where we learned the history of our country (and the constitution) and that of other countries are well. A country where we were taught about democracy vs. dictatorship.

And now? Things will change.

No more privacy with my doctor who took an oath. My body will now be watched by politicians who do not even know me nor care about my health if I should suffer a miscarriage. Now we will no longer care for or about one another. Now we will hate each other more rather than working out our differences. Now companies will be leaving the country for lower wages or just shutting down -- look at the Rust Belt.

Now our lives and those of our allies will be in peril because he wants to take us out of NATO. Now our climate will be only worse because "there is nothing to climate changes." Now any health care you have, Social Security, Medicare, Medicaid, will either be taken away or reduced. Now our food will probably become scarce or limited in supply due to the fact that the big farms will go bankrupt while our food rots in the fields because they don't have migrant workers for the fields (which many think to be beneath us.)

So much for the America I was raised in. It is no longer the land of the free and the brave. It is the land of a dictator.
